Learn key facts about Certificate in Refugee Law
The Certificate in Refugee Law is a specialized program designed to equip students with the knowledge and skills necessary to work in the field of refugee law.
This program is typically offered by law schools and universities, and its duration can vary depending on the institution and the student's prior experience.
The Certificate in Refugee Law is usually a postgraduate program, taking around 6-12 months to complete, although some institutions may offer part-time or online options.
Upon completion of the program, students can expect to gain a deeper understanding of refugee law, including its history, principles, and current developments.
The program covers a range of topics, including international refugee law, national refugee law, asylum procedures, and the rights of refugees and asylum seekers.
